Lully, Lulley, Lully, Lulley,
The faucon hath borne my mak away.

He bare hym up, he bare hym down,
He bare hym into an orchard brown.

And in that orchard there was a hall,
That was covered in purple and pall.

And in that hall there was a bede,
Hit was hanged with gold so rede.

In that bede there lythe a knyght,
His wounde bledeth day and nyght.

And by that bedes side ther knelth a may,
And she wepeth both both night and day.

And by that beddes side there stondeth a ston,
Corpus Christi wretyn theryn.
